“While it’s true that every cause you have set into motion will eventuate in a corresponding effect, don’t start looking over your shoulder for your past to catch up with you! Know why? Because you can always put a new cause into motion. That should be a comforting thought, considering all of the foolish things you may have done in the past. If you are dissatisfied with a part of your life, know that it is the effect of a cause that you have put into motion and that at any time you can start again. Your new cause will bring a new effect. The measure you give will be the measure you get.”

Richard and Mary-Alice Jafolla, in “The Quest”
